James K. Galbraith is an advisor to former Greek Finance Minister Yanis Varoufakis. He is also a founding member of DiEM25, an economist who writes often for the popular press, and a professor at the University of Texas at Austin. We spoke about the Greek debt crisis, inequality, and U.S. politics.
